An instrumentation service brochure provides information to help equipment to continue to deliver optimum efficiency with minimal disruption throughout its lifecycle.

ABB has released its Instrumentation Service Brochure detailing its full range of after sales support and services for instrumentation equipment ABB said that the brochure provides plant operators with all they need to know to ensure that their equipment continues to deliver optimum efficiency with minimal disruption throughout its lifecycle

The 16-page brochure presents a choice of three levels of service for instrumentation equipment, from the 'entry level' InstrumentationAdvantage scheme through to the more comprehensive InstrumentationActive and Instrumentation Active+ programmes.

The brochure explains what's included within each scheme and highlights the types of applications to which each is best suited.

* InstrumentationAdvantage - an entry level service package to help users optimise instrument performance and ensure problem-free operation.

It includes installation, commissioning and validation support, backed by ABB's experts.

* InstrumentationActive - provides the added security of 24/7 support and access to technical expertise and assistance, ideal for more complex instruments and applications.

This option includes a range of complementary services such as telephone support, corrective and preventive maintenance and calibration and verification assistance, which can be combined to meet individual needs.

* InstrumentationActive+ - a range of specialised services, which delivers a full lifecycle management programme.

The package provides a customised solution to prolonging the performance of critical equipment through targeted maintenance and upgrades, based on the probability of failure and the severity of the consequences.

With the right consideration, said ABB to manufacturingtalk.com, a good instrument maintenance plan, including verification, calibration and routine checks, can be invaluable in ensuring reliable, energy efficient plant performance.

The brochure forms part of ABB's commitment to helping plant operators to achieve these goals through effective lifecycle management.

Service manager for ABB UK's instrumentation business, Neil Ritchie, said: "More and more companies are choosing instruments with good predictive and diagnostic capabilities to help them minimise the waste in energy, materials and resources caused by poorly controlled processes.

Nevertheless, it is vital that they protect their investment with an expert lifecycle management programme that considers the handling of both planned and unplanned maintenance for their plant, which is where ABB can help.".
